Traditional cost systems with a single-allocation base tend to overcost high-volume products and undercost low-volume products as compared to activity-based costing systems.
Operational Effectiveness
The ability of an organization to perform activities efficiently and effectively, maximizing the value of resources used.
Electronic Commerce
The buying and selling of goods or services using the internet, and the transfer of money and data to execute these transactions.
Internet
A global network of computers that provides a wide range of information and communication facilities, including access to websites and other services.
Information Technologies
Systems, software, and equipment designed to store, retrieve, transmit, and manipulate data, significantly influencing the operation of businesses and societies.
